Job Summary

Master Technology Group (MTG) specializes in designing, installing, and servicing commercial property technologies across local and national markets. The ERP Analyst will provide Enterprise Resource Planning (ERP) systems and operational support throughout the project life cycle. The ideal candidate will play a key role in the advanced customization, configuration, and maintenance of MTG’s ERP systems. This position involves in-depth analysis and testing of ERP processes and reporting to ensure optimal performance and alignment with corporate goals. The ERP Analyst collaborates with senior team members and provides expertise in addressing complex ERP‑related challenges. In addition, the ERP Analyst will periodically support the Operations team in executing technology‑related projects for our clients. To succeed, the ERP Analyst must possess excellent customer service skills and maintain strong professional relationships with all stakeholders, including employees, clients, vendors, and partners. Strong communication, administrative skills, organizational and multi‑tasking capabilities are vital. The position is a full‑time, in‑office role that reports to the Manager of IT and Business Transformation.

Key Duties and Responsibilities
  • Lead in the customization and configuration of advanced ERP workflows
  • Conduct in‑depth analysis of ERP systems to identify areas for improvement and optimization
  • Collaborate with senior team members and cross‑functional teams to gather requirements, design process improvements, and implement ERP solutions
  • Perform comprehensive testing of ERP workflows to ensure compliance with corporate needs and industry standards
  • Provide support for end‑users and troubleshoot ERP‑related issues
  • Stay abreast of emerging ERP technologies and contribute to the continuous improvement of ERP processes
  • Gain a thorough understanding of MTG services and operational processes
  • Tracking and reporting overall progress and milestone status to Coordinators and Project Managers as needed
  • Develop and maintain positive relationships with clients, fellow employees, vendors, and local service providers
  • Coordinate resources to support the project completion process and assist with post‑install document/program creation
  • Administrative responsibility to support systems utilization, including but not limited to managing security settings, user access, change requests, and overall system configuration
  • Stay informed of and communicate updates and improvements to systems and operational processes
  • Coordinate reporting needs, generate reporting, and conduct high‑level data analysis to support leadership in data‑driven decision‑making
  • Develop custom reports based on departmental and overall company goals
  • Evaluate and optimize workflow and define best practices
  • Other related duties as required or assigned
